BackgroundIntracranial aneurysms is a limitated protuberance of cerebral arteries formed by abnormally enlarged cerebral wall,which is the primary factor of spontaneous intracranial subarachnoid hemorrhage.About 20%of the patients died from the first bleeding because of no treat in time.Microsurgical and interventional surgery are the two main ways of clinical treatment of ruptured aneurysms.Aneurysm clipping is the "gold standard" in the treatment of aneurysms in the past and has 60 years of history.How to make the aneurysm clipping operation more minimally invasive is a challenge for craniotomy surgeon.In recent years,interventional therapy developed rapidly and has become an important means for the treatment of intracranial aneurysms.Usually for anterior circulation aneurysms,two kinds of treatment efficacy,but postoperative recurrence rate is low by microsurgery.For aneurysms of posterior circulation,due to the deep location,intervention treatment usually preferred.For elderly patients,interventional embolization is also priority given.The literature reported that there was still a high recurrence rate after embolization of aneurysms.The study showed that the recurrence of aneurysms was related to the density of the embolization,and the more dense the embolism was,the lower the recurrence rate was.Aneurysms in different parts of the different characteristics.Individualized treatment of aneurysms,we need to explore.Anterior communicating artery aneurysms in intracranial aneurysms accounted for the highest proportion.Due to the deep location,usually choose interventional embolization.The study on individualized treatment of anterior communicating artery aneurysms were sumimarized and analyzed.In addition,wide neck,irregular aneurysms currently used stent assisted embolization,but in acute cerebral hemorrhage,stent application still exist certain risks,including thromboembolic events after surgery and the risk of bleeding,and the application of double catheter technique can avoid stent application.Based on this,this study also made a retrospective analysis of the application of double micro catheter technique in the treatment of intracranial complex irregular aneurysms.Oculomotor nerve palsy is a typical clinical manifestation of posterior communicating artery aneurysms.Interventional embolization and craniotomy clipping are also some helpful to the recovery of oculomotor nerve paralysis.However,there is no definite conclusion about which treatment is more beneficial to the recovery of oculomotor nerve palsy.In the past literature reports,the results were different because of limited number of cases.In this study,we retrospectively analyzed the cases of posterior communicating artery aneurysms with oculomotor nerve palsy in single center.It is found that the recovery rate of oculomotor nerve paralysis is higher in patients undergoing craniotomy clipping.In view of the above problems in the surgical treatment of intracranial aneurysms,a retrospective study of the clinical data of Anhui Provincial Hospital over the past four years was conducted to provide the basis for the surgical treatment of intracranial aneurysms.The research is divided into four parts:Comparison of the efficacy of surgical clipping and embolization for oculomotor nervepalsy due to aposterior communicating artery aneurysm(the first part).Lateral supraorbital approach microsurgical clipping of intracranial anterior circulation aneurysms(part second).Individualized interventional embolization treatment of ruptured anterior communicating artery aneurysms(Part third).Fndovascular treatment of irregular and complicated intracranial aneurysms with coils by double microcatheter technique(Part fourth).Section ? Comparison of the efficacy of surgical clipping and embolization for oculomotor nervepalsy due to aposterior communicating artery aneurysmObjective To aim at the efficacies of surgical clipping and endovascular embolization for oculomotor nerve palsy(ONP)as treatments for posterior communicating artery aneurysm(PcoAA),and the comparison and various influencing factors of the treatments.Methods A retrospective analysis of the clinical data of 52 enrolled PcoAA patients with ONP who had treatment in the Department of Neurosurgery in Anhui provincial Hospital from January 2011 to June 2015 was conducted.There were 23 patients among a total underwent surgical clippings and others 29 patients received endovascular embolization treatment.Then,the age,gender,aneurysm size and rupture status,onset duration,preoperative ONP severity and postoperative recovery degree of ONP of patients in the two groups were compared.The factors affecting the degree of recovery from ONP were analyzed using multivariate logisticregression.Results The final ONP outcomes of the 52 PcoAA patients consisted of 27 full recovery patients(51.9%),21 partial recovery patients(40.4%),and 4 no recovery patients(7.7%).(1)Within the 23 patients in the surgical clipping group,subarachnoid hemorrhage(SAH)occurred in 16 patients,and no SAH occurrence in the other 7 patients;the final ONP evaluation showed 18 patients fully recovered(78.3%)and 5 patients partially recovered(21.7%).Within the 29 patient's in the endovascular embolization group,SAH occurred in 18 patients,and no SAH occurrence in the other 11 patients;the final ONP evaluation showed 9 patients fully recovered(31%),16 patients partially recovered in 16 patients(55.2%)and 4 no recovery patients(13.8%).(2)The postoperative ONP recovery was analyzed with multi-variate logistic regression,and the treatment method was an independent factor for ONP recovery(OR=0.041,95%CI:0.007-0.261,p<0.01).Conclusions When compared with the endovascular embolization,the surgical clipping showed a better efficacy in the recovery from PcoAA related ONP.Section ? Lateral supraorbital approach microsurgical clipping of intracranial anterior circulation aneurysmsObjective To summarize the experience of microsurgical treatment of intracranial anterior circulation aneurysms with lateral supraorbital approach.Analyze the feasibility,advantages and disadvantages of the lateral supraorbital approach,and to provide a safe and minimally invasive approach for microsurgical treatment of anterior circulation aneurysms.Methods Clinical datas(including aneurysm distribution,complications and prognosis GOS score,etc.)were retrospectively analyzed from January 2013 to June 2014 using the lateral supraorbital approach to treat intracranial anterior circulation aneurysms.Results 62 patients with a total of 72 aneurysms,of which 9 cases multiple aneurysms,all aneurysms were clipped.59 cases recovered well,moderate disability in 1 case,mild disability in 2 cases,no mortality.Conclusions lateral upraorbital approach is more simple and efficient than traditional pterional approach,especially suitable for patients with aneurysms within Hunt-Hess grade ?.Section ? Individualized interventional embolization treatment of ruptured anterior communicating artery aneurysmsObjective To summarize the experience of endovascular embolization for the treatment of ruptured anterior communicating artery aneurysm,and to explore the therapeutic effect of endovascular embolization and the method to reduce the complications.Methods A retrospective study was applied on 126 cases with anterior communicating artery aneurysms which were treated by endovascular embolization in the Department of Neurosurgery of Anhui provincial Hospita from January 2011 to December 2013,The data collected included sex,age,Hunt-Hess classification,aneurysm distribution,treatment time,surgical complications,etc.according to Hunt-Hess classification:grade ?22 cases,grade ? 56 cases,grade ? 35 cases,grade ? 13 cases.Results This group of 126 patients were all treated by endovascular embolization.107 cases treated with single catheter embolization,11 cases treated with stent assisted embolization,4 cases treated with balloon assisted embolization,4 cases treated with double catheter embolization.Successful embolization occurred in 123 cases.According to the classification of Raymond,the embolization degree of the aneurysm was evaluated.Raymond grade I embolization was performed in 98 cases(79.6%),and Raymond ? embolization was performed in 25 cases(20.4%).The patients were followed up for 6 months to 4 years,and 4 cases recurred.3 of them were completely embolized again.1 cases underwent clipping by craniotomy.No rebleeding case.Conclusions Endovascular embolization is an effective method for the treatment of anterior communicating artery aneurysms.Individualized treatment,early embolization,better embolization techniques,and early postoperative drainage of hemorrhagic cerebrospinal fluid can reduce complications.Section IV Endovascular treatment of irregular and complicated intracranial aneurysms with coils by double microcatheter techniqueObjective To summarize preliminary experience in the endovascular treatment of irregular and complicated intracranial aneurysm with coils by double micro catheter technique,and to evaluate its feasibility and advantage.Methods A retrospective study was applied on 37 cases with irregular and complicated intracranial aneurysms which were treated by using double microcatheter method from July 2013 to May 2015.Follow-up after patients discharged 6 months.The data collected included gender,age,Hunt-Hess classification,aneurysm distribution,treatment time,surgical complications,and so on.Results All aneurysms were successfully embolized with double micro catheter technique.Immediate postemboliz,ation angiography showed no residual contrast filling in 35 cases,and redidual filling in 2 cases.At discharge,according to modified Rankin Scale(mRS),all patients recovered well,no complications and no deaths occurred.Follow-up in 24 cases by DSA after 6 months,no recanalization was found.Conclusions Double Micro-catheter technique for irregular shape intracranial aneurysms has a good effect,simple operation,fewer complications.
